Why Do you need an Electricians?

The main reason you should hire a professional electrician is for you and your family's safety. Dealing with electricity can be dangerous if you don't approach it with the right expertise, training, and equipment. Here are some electrical problems that you might need to hire:

Light Flickers when you're using the appliances

When all the appliances are plugged, there's a change in the load in the electrical circuit which causes your lights to flicker. Though this is less hazardous for some reason, it will damage your appliances. When this problem occurs, it is best to hire an electrician or some expert who can do the job.

Frequent Electrical Surges

Usually, frequent surges are caused by either bad wiring or too many of electrical devices. This issue is not good as it might damage your appliances. If this continuesly occur, ask for electrical service to check the status of your electrical wiring.

Electrical Shocks

Electrical shocks can happen when a device is turned on and off. Reasons for this is bad wiring or lack of electricity supply.

Warm Switches and Outlets

Have you ever touched a switch that felt warmer than usual? This could be a sign that to much electricity is running through them. You need to unplug your devices as it may cause damage. Replacing a new switch is one of the best ways. But to make sure you're installing it in the right way, better to ask for an electrician.
